Light level of sensitivity may indicate a more serious issue and is an usual signs and symptom of a number of eye conditions, illness, and infections
Seasonal allergic reactions can make our eyes dry and scratchy, as can extended display usage.
They are triggered by little bits of healthy protein and other cells that are embedded in the clear, gel-like material (called vitreous) which fills up the inside of our eye. As we mature the glasslike ends up being even more fluid, making the little bits of healthy protein and various other cells more recognizable. Some drifters (specifically those come with by flashes of light) may show a really severe condition, such as a removed retina.
Make an emergency situation visit with your optometrist or continue to the nearest emergency space. Many retinal detachments can be repaired if they are treated soon, but if they are not dealt with in time you may experience a loss of vision or perhaps blindness. According to the Canadian Association of Optometrists adults with healthy eyes in between the ages of 20 and 39 must see their ophthalmologist every 2 to 3 years. Adults between the ages of 40 and 64 must make a consultation when every 2 years, and grownups over the age of 64 ought to see their optometrist yearly.

The retina is the slim layer of cells that lines the inner component of the rear of the eyeball. Its function is to obtain light and send out visual vision center south enterprise signals to the mind.

Glaucoma is an eye problem that can lead to irreparable vision loss. It occurs when fluid accumulates within the eye. The excess liquid taxes sensitive retinal nerve fibers, creating damages to the optic nerve. Without treatment, this can cause a person to gradually lose their peripheral vision.
